Java Collection 接口
提问人:刘旭39发布时间:2020-11-27
Collection 接口
Collection是最基本的集合类接口,可以认为它是描述了一系列相同功能接口的共性接口。 Collection接口中提供了通用的对集合内元素操作的方法,Collection的子类会实现这些方法。
CoUection的子类一些是具体类,可以直接使用;另外一些是抽象类,提供了Collection接口的部分 实现。
java.util.AbstractCollection类提供了Collection的默认实现,可以创建AhstractCollection的子类。 在实际的开发中,Java提供了大量类似的基础接口的实现,方便开发者使用。同时,开发者也可以 自定义实现Collection类,但是必须同时实现itoator()等方法。
Collection接口同时继承了Iterable接口,因此Collection的所有子类(List类、Set类等)也都 实现了ItwaMe接口 D Iterable是Java集合的顶级接口之一,这个接口中提供了三个方法,分别是 fofEach()、iterator()splitpnxtorOo三个方法中最常用的是iterator(),它可以通过迭代器遍历自身元 素,也就是查询整个集合的所有元素。
代码如下
继续查找其他问题的答案?
相关视频回答
回复(0)
点击加载更多评论>>